Pertanyaan Xcode 4 - IB - mendistribusikan kontrol secara merata?


Di Antarmuka Builder saya memiliki banyak bidang teks yang duduk secara vertikal. Saya ingin mereka terdistribusi secara merata di ruang vertikal, dan semua untuk ukuran identik.

Saya telah menemukan menu Alignment yang memungkinkan Anda menyusun item. Saya tidak dapat menemukan menu untuk distribusi atau ukuran. Apakah Xcode 4 menyertakan perintah tata letak itu?


11
2018-05-08 13:40


asal


Jawaban:


Jawaban yang membosankan adalah mengetikkan koordinat secara manual. Tidak terlalu mulus, tetapi memberikan Anda kontrol yang tepat atas penempatan setidaknya (dalam inspektur Ukuran).


1
2017-07-25 21:35



Jawabannya adalah, TIDAK. Dan saya BENCI harus menjadi "salah satu dari orang-orang itu" yang harus memberitahumu. saya menganggap apa yang Anda cari adalah sesuatu yang mirip dengan fitur klasik OmniGraffle, "Canvas, Grid, Alignment". Ini adalah ALAT yang membuat OG sangat terkutuk.

alignment, dumbies

Ini mengherankan / membuat saya jijik bahwa sebuah perusahaan senilai $ 100 miliar tidak bisa mendapatkan prinsip dasar tata letak visual yang tepat, ketika perusahaan yang menulis perangkat lunak untuk platform perusahaan bodoh itu sendiri selama bertahun-tahun, telah mengalami penurunan selama yang saya ingat. Tim Xcode perlu menariknya bersama. Sebagai contoh, KVO Bindings adalah, dan selalu menjadi lelucon - yang tidak terlalu lucu - yang tidak mungkin untuk diimplementasikan, plug-in hilang ... Dan IMHO, tata letak otomatis Lion tidak dapat digunakan. Mereka membutuhkan ORANG BARU atau sesuatu, mungkin itu bukan pengembang, atau sesuatu.. Karena Xcode semakin sulit digunakan, tidak mudah. Ini terlihat lebih baik, dan lebih terorganisir ... tetapi jelas bahwa tidak ada "pemikir besar" di dalam kelompok itu yang bersedia mempertanyakan paradigma mereka yang rapuh dan canggung.

the jokes on us, lion autolayout

Apakah mereka bercanda dengan ini? Bagaimana dengan Xcode ini? _Tutup, susun tombolnya, distribusikan kemudian secara merata - seperti 99% orang akan menginginkan, 99% waktu - dan jangan muntah baris yang tidak berarti di semua hal? __ Dan apa apaan aku s Content Hugging Priority dan Content Compression Resistance Priority? Saya membaca dokumen dua kali dan masih TIDAK MEMILIKI IDEA apa itu atau bagaimana cara menggunakannya. Saya bukan Einstein, tetapi Jika saya tidak bisa "mendapatkannya" setelah melakukan upaya bersama ... Ini terlalu sulit. lol. Ok, aku harus pergi menandai sia-sia dari daftar to-do saya, sekarang.


27
2018-04-07 19:48



Semoga ini membantu: https://developer.apple.com/library/ios/documentation/UserExperience/Conceptual/AutolayoutPG/AutoLayoutbyExample/AutoLayoutbyExample.html

Konsepnya adalah menggunakan beberapa tampilan spacer dan mengaturnya menjadi ukuran yang sama. Ada beberapa trik dengan prioritas yang harus dilakukan jadi tolong ikuti tautan untuk jawaban yang pasti.


2
2018-01-06 16:29